Saturday, April 25, 2009

Video: American Legion gets apology from Napolitano

Click the title to go to Hot Air for the interview. Janet Napolitano should resign immediately for this monumental failure of a report. Of course the Homeland Security report also distrust those who display the Don't Tread On Me flag. This administration is apparently all slow learners, and to think we have 44 months to go.

